CONTROL SYSTEM AND METHOD - A simplified explanation of the abstract

This abstract first appeared for US patent application 18547110 titled 'CONTROL SYSTEM AND METHOD

The patent application describes a control system for a motor vehicle that receives motion control signals from a remote device and responds by controlling the vehicle's motion.

  • The control system sends a verification request signal to the remote device and waits for a verification request reply signal in response.
  • Upon receiving the reply signal, the system compares it to an expected signal to verify the authenticity of the communication.
  • If the reply signal matches the expected signal, the system uses the motion control signal from the remote device to control the vehicle's motion.

Original Abstract Submitted

A control system is arranged to control, or provide input to a system to control, motion of a motor vehicle in response to a motion control signal received from a remote device, wherein the control system is configured to: transmit a verification request signal to the remote device; listen for a verification request reply signal transmitted from the remote device in response to the verification request signal transmitted; compare, in the event that a verification request reply signal is received from the remote device, the verification request reply signal to an expected verification request reply signal; and control, or provide input to a system to control motion of the vehicle in response to a motion control signal received from the remote device based on receipt of a verification request reply signal corresponding to the expected verification request reply signal.
